Published by PHI Learning (Prentice-Hall of India), the book aims to bridge the gap between abstract mathematical theory and practical, applied techniques. It is known for its rigorous treatment of complex analysis while keeping the mathematical exposition manageable and focused.

Results are often accompanied by geometric insights to make abstract analysis more accessible.
